Address 2.76355924 OWC

AYwvmsdnL9JRdpUbgGJHwmRYHS2Z3xtDNP

Confirmed

Total Received2232.18666561 OWC
Total Sent2229.42310637 OWC
Final Balance2.76355924 OWC
No. Transactions76

Transactions

AYwvmsdnL9JRdpUbgGJHwmRYHS2Z3xtDNP43.75717736 OWC
AZiBvJezKL9LuMXvkvqu8x264Dw8xfRsp35.5 OWC
Fee: 0.0001 OWC
1255602 Confirmations49.25717736 OWC